    LOUIS: SIMON'S HAD BOOB JOB
    By Dan Wootton

    TELLY judge Louis Walsh claims Simon Cowell has had surgery to give him the PECS factor.

    The Irishman reckons his X Factor co-star has chest implants to look butch and compares his gleaming white teeth to "piano keys".

    In fact Louis, 55, says ALL the other judges have gone under the knife. He insists: "They all have new t*ts...and lots of other work done. I'm the only one who hasn't had plastic surgery. Simon's definitely had a boob job. But Sharon has the best surgeon. She's going to give me her doctor's number.

    "Honestly, I'm serious. I just want maintenance though, not everything like the others. I want to get really nice white teeth—but not like Simon's piano keys which are not his own."

    But Louis reckons it's only Simon's teeth that are whiter than white, saying: "He's more vicious than Sharon and Dannii!"

    His own battles with Simon on the ITV1 reality show are legendary but Louis says he refuses to be Cowelled.

    "I can get him back for anything he says to me," he boasts. "It's water off a duck's back."

    And he gleefully admits the judges' feuds and antics now overshadow the singers.

    Clash

    He chuckles: "I feel like I'm in a soap opera. What goes on behind the scenes would be the best TV series in the whole world. Anything can happen.

    "I think sometimes we're more interesting than the contestants."

    However so-called happy slapper Emily Nakanda, filmed on a mobile attacking a girl, stole the headlines last week. Louis backed the decision to boot her out. He fumed: "There is no place for any kind of bullying on X Factor."

    But he thinks Sharon Osborne's backstage bust-up with new judge Dannii Minogue was simply a clash of two dominant personalities.

    "Both want to be Queen Bee," says Louis, who manages Westlife. "Sharon's Queen Bee in my book and Dannii is the new kid on the block.

    "But they've sorted themselves out. I can see them becoming good friends by the end of the series."

    However he insists that Sharon's shock on-air resignation was no stunt. He recalled: "I didn't know she was going to walk off. I called her after and she said, ‘Everything just got to me'. She was seriously considering walking away. It was NOT a publicity stunt.

    "But she knew she had to come back for her two acts. It's life, it's real. It's part Jerry Springer. And I stick by Sharon totally. She was loyal to me when I when I was sacked.

    "They can't replace her because there's no-one else like her. And Simon Cowell cannot control her. That's what makes it fantastic telly."

    But he thinks Dannii is struggling. He says: "She is not picking the right songs for her guys. After 27 years in the business I don't know why she can't pick better ones.

    Of the current crop he said: "There's four good people in there this year—Rhydian, Beverley, Niki and Futureproof. Niki has an amazing voice. She could win the contest.

    But Louis is back to his bitchy best summing up rival Strictly Come Dancing on BBC1. He sniped: "It's just boring. It's for older safe people.

    "The judges are boring. They should get rid of them and get young people in. Bruce Forsyth is so old he makes Arlene Phillips look young.

    "I definitely don't want her cosmetic surgeon."

    Futureproof: Hope "detest" each other

    Futureproof's Richard Wilkinson has claimed that X Factor contestants Hope "detest" each other.

    Wilkinson, whose band were voted off the show on Saturday, argued that the girl group would split as soon as they leave the programme because of personality differences.

    He told DS: "We knew right from the start when we were put together at boot camp that no matter what, we knew we would stay together as a group.

    "Whereas with Hope, if they get put out of the competition, a couple of the members really do detest each other. Because we've heard them arguing!

    "There's no way that if they were put out of the competition that they'd stay together. Raquel would definitely be out chasing a solo career somewhere."

    Futureproof lost out to Hope during Saturday's showdown, with mentor Simon Cowell and judges Louis Walsh and Sharon Osbourne favouring the all-female act.
